Hobby Lobby stopped carrying Tamiya Extra Thin Cement awhile back, but now carries the Mr Hobby line Mr Cement S liquid model cement.
Has anybody here used this stuff, and if so, how does it compare to Tamiya Extra Thin? I mainly ask because the closest Hobby Lobby is much closer than the closest real hobby shops are, and if I need supplies, it’s a much easier errand to run.

I have used it, the cement characteristics are pretty much the same, perhaps the viscosity is slightly thicker.
However, the biggest concrete difference is the built-in brush, which is significantly bigger than Tamiyas.
The brush of my Mr Cement S has become pretty used as seen in the picture.
BUT, I made back in 2019’a simpel test of different cements, of which Mr Cement S also was included in.
